I agree with Wrex here, points down to 10th is good. However, I believe most laps led and pole position could each get a point.

I don't agree with fastest lap. Picture this hypothetical at the final race at Suzuka. TGF needs one point to clinch the championship from DC. Schumacher is in 2nd behind DC and is continually slowing (to get clear track). At the 1st pitstop Ferrari hardly put any fuel in and whack on some new rubber. Schuey goes back out and sets a lap time 1.5 seconds faster than anybody else to get that point and claim the title. He then runs off the road several times before crashing into the barriers. DC drives an absolutely stunning race and finishes miles ahead of anyone else only to lose the championship.

But remember, FIA do not provide transportation subsidies to teams who score nil points, and they do not get split money to those who fail to score any points. All these would only mean FIA have to recount their accounts...


But to incorporate everyone's idea with mine, i would suggest:
1st)15pts
2nd)10pts
3rd)7pts
4th)5pts
5th)4pts
6th)3pts
7th)2pts
8th)1pt

Fastest Qualifying) 2pt
Fastest Lap in Race/Practice 0pt

And instead of the current system that only teams who score at least one pt for the whole season qualify for FIA funds, perhaps only those who score at least 5 points get the money...thus making all teams work harder over a whole season to make their cars competitive.

This is to get rid of the current loophole, because currrently, Minardi (for example) could just run their year-old car for the first race Australia, and finish the race with reliability, and most probably finish in the points, thus they could just sit back for the rest of the year yet qualify for the money.
